US backs Strauss-Kahn for top IMF post

Published September 19th, 2007


The United States on Wednesday backed European Union candidate Dominique Strauss-Kahn to head the International Monetary Fund, virtually assuring the Frenchman's victory as the selection process neared a conclusion.
